一种用于无线路由器的ip带宽平均分配系统的制作方法

文档序号:8433712阅读:338来源:国知局
一种用于无线路由器的ip带宽平均分配系统的制作方法
【技术领域】
[0001]本发明涉及一种用于无线路由器的IP带宽平均分配系统,属于无线通信的技术领域。
【背景技术】
[0002]随着无线通信技术的发展,无线网络的应用越来越普及,给人们的生活带来了许多方便,用户数量也因此急剧增多。在无线网络中,无线路由器是应用于用户上网、带有无线覆盖功能的路由器,在无线网络中,无线路由器可以看作一个转发器,将接出的宽带网络信号通过天线转发给附近的无线网络设备,如笔记本电脑、支持wifi的手机等,以及所有带有WIFI功能的设备,因此在无线网络中起到重要作用。
[0003]对于无线网络来说,网络带宽作为衡量网络使用情况的一个重要指标,日益受到人们的普遍关注。它不仅是政府或单位制订网络通信发展策略的重要依据,也是互联网用户和单位选择互联网接入服务商的主要因素之一。在无线局域网下,无线路由器IP带宽控制是基于IP地址控制的,因此在IP地址的基础上分配带宽至关重要。
[0004]但是,在实际过程中,IP带宽分配上存在各种问题。如在中国发明专利申请一种无线网络带宽监控方法及系统,申请号:201410219911.3,申请日:2014-05-22的文件中,公开了“所述方法包括:实时监测无线网络的信号强度;在监测到无线网络的信号强度发生变化时,以虚拟无效IP为发送原点向无线网络的接口 IP发送一数据容量为a的还回报文,并记录该还回报文从原点发出至返回原点所用的时间t ;将无线网络当前的带宽修正为2a/t”,由此来解决了无线网络中带宽容易丢失的问题,根据该发明的无线网络带宽监控方法及系统,对无线网络的信号强度进行实时监控,并在信号强度发生变化时通过发送还回报文的方式测试该无线网络的带宽,实现了实时修正无线网络带宽的真实值,充分利用了无线网络的带宽,从而避免了数据丢失,且提高了无线网络带宽的使用效率,还降低了网络使用成本,因此一定程度上客服了现有的无线网络中的不足。
[0005]而在另外一篇中国发明申请名称为检测IP网络带宽的方法和装置,申请号:201110444012.X,申请日:2011-12-27的文件中,公开了 “一种种检测IP网络带宽的方法和装置,能够检测IP网络带宽,又不会占用过多的存储空间。小基站从服务器下载文件数据,所述小基站经由IP网络连接到所述服务器;所述小基站利用虚拟文件系统将接收到的数据存储到内存的缓存区,并记录累计下载的数据长度;所述小基站在缓存区满后,释放所述缓存区;所述小基站在所述文件下载完成后,记录下载所述文件总计消耗时间,根据所述文件总长度和所述总计消耗时间计算所述IP网络下行链路带宽”,由此来解决IP网络带宽的检测问题,能够在检测IP网络带宽时有效地节约小基站存储空间。但是,尽管如此,仍然无法解决现有的无线路由器在IP分配上平均分配的问题。
[0006]因此,现有的无线路由器在组建的无线网络中,无法检测无线设备的数量,对总带宽无法做到平均分配,不具备自动分配功能,使得连入的设备容易造成IP带宽分配不均匀,导致整个网络占用不均匀。

【发明内容】

[0007]本发明所要解决的技术问题在于克服现有技术的不足,提供一种用于无线路由器的IP带宽平均分配系统,解决无法根据连入的无线设备数量,对总带宽平均分配的问题,实现IP带宽平均分配。
[0008]本发明具体采用以下技术方案解决上述技术问题:
无线路由器,用于建立无线局域网并与外部设备建立无线连接;
连接状态查询模块,用于查询连接状态为成功的设备;
数量统计模块,用于统计查询连接状态为成功的设备总数量;
处理模块,包括带宽获取模块、带宽计算模块、带宽分配模块,其中带宽获取模块用于获取无线路由器总带宽;所述带宽计算模块用于根据所述带宽获取模块获得总带宽和数量统计模块获得的设备总数量,计算获得每个连入设备的平均带宽;所述带宽分配模块用于根据所获得的每个连入设备的平均带宽对无线路由器的总带宽进行分配和设置。
[0009]进一步地,作为本发明的一种优选技术方案:所述连接状态查询模块为实时查询连接状态为成功的设备。
[0010]进一步地,作为本发明的一种优选技术方案:还包括与连接状态查询模块相连的计时模块,所述计时模块用于设置预定时间,在时间到达预定时间时生成触发信号至连接状态查询模块。
[0011]进一步地,作为本发明的一种优选技术方案:还包括与连接状态查询模块相连的复位模块。
[0012]进一步地,作为本发明的一种优选技术方案:所述带宽计算模块采用AT89S51型单片机。
[0013]本发明采用上述技术方案,能产生如下技术效果:
(I)、本发明的用于无线路由器的IP带宽平均分配系统,通过无线路由器在建立无线局域网的基础上与无线设备连接,对连接成功的设备数量进行统计,并根据总的IP带宽数结合实际中的连入设备数量获得平均分配带宽,然后对无线路由器按照计算所得的平均分配带宽数分配,因此,可以充分利用带宽资源,为连入的设备平均分配,提高带宽资源的使用效率,具备自动分配功能,使得连入的设备容易造成IP带宽分配均匀,导致整个网络的带宽均匀被分配。
[0014](2)、进一步地,可以形成实时或根据时间来生成触发信号控制查询连入设备的状态,由此可以充分做到实时检测或间断检测,更加方便用户使用,可以更加方便的提供触发信号为平均分配做基础。
【附图说明】
[0015]图1为本发明的用于无线路由器的IP带宽平均分配系统的模块示意图。
【具体实施方式】
[0016]下面结合说明书附图,对本发明的实施方式进行描述。
[0017]如图1所示,本发明设计了一种用于无线路由器的IP带宽平均分配系统,包括:无线路由器,用于建立无线局域网并与外部设备建立无线连接;连接状态查询模块,用于查询连接状态为成功的设备;数量统计模块,用于统计查询连接状态为成功的设备总数量;
处理模块,包括带宽获取模块、带宽计算模块、带宽分配模块,其中带宽获取模块用于获取无线路由器总带宽;所述带宽计算模块用于根据所述带宽获取模块获得总带宽和数量统计模块获得的设备总数量,计算获得每个连入设备的平均带宽;所述带宽分配模块用于根据所获得的每个连入设备的平均带宽对无线路由器的总带宽进行分配和设置。因此,可以充分利用带宽资源,为连入的设备平均分配,提高带宽资源的使用效率,具备自动分配功會K。
[0018]在系统中,所述连接状态查询模块可以根据用户需要进行设置,可以设置成实时检测状态,只要连入成功无线设备,即触发连接状态查询模块进行检测,或是设置间断检测状态,即系统还包括与连接状态查询模块相连的计时模块,所述计时模块用于设置预定时间,在时间到达预定时间时生成触发信号至连接状态查询模块,连接状态查询模块对连入设备进行检测,由此可以充分做到实时检测或间断检测,更加方便用户使用,可以更加方便的提供触发信号为平均分配做基础。
[0019]并且,在系统的实际过程中,还可以包括与连接状态查询模块连接的复位模块,利用复位模块在连入无线设备有更新时手动复位,让系统处于重新检测和计算状态,便于紧急情况下对IP带宽的分配。
[0020]对于处理模块中的带宽计算模块,可以优选采用AT89S51型单片机,它的EEPROM电可擦除技术闪速存储器技术和质量高可靠性的生产技术在CMOS器件生产领域中ATMEL的先进设计水平优秀的生产工艺及封装技术一直处于世界的领先地位,这些技术用于单片机生产使单片机也具有优秀的品质在结构性能和功能等方面都有明显的优势,ATMEL公司的单片机是目前世界上一种独具特色而性能卓越的单片机,AT89S51是用高密度的16位指令集实现了高效的32位RISC结构且功耗很低.,因此可以方便的用于降低整个系统的成本。
[0021]因此,本发明的用于无线路由器的IP带宽平均分配系统,通过无线路由器在建立无线局域网的基础上与无线设备连接,对连接成功的设备数量进行统计,并根据总的IP带宽数结合实际中的连入设备数量获得平均分配带宽,然后对无线路由器按照计算所得的平均分配带宽数分配,因此,可以充分利用带宽资源,为连入的设备平均分配,提高带宽资源的使用效率,具备自动分配功能,使得连入的设备容易造成IP带宽分配均匀,导致整个网络的带宽均匀被分配。
[0022]上面结合附图对本发明的实施方式作了详细说明,但是本发明并不限于上述实施方式,在本领域普通技术人员所具备的知识范围内,还可以在不脱离本发明宗旨的前提下做出各种变化。
【主权项】
1.一种用于无线路由器的IP带宽平均分配系统,其特征在于,包括: 无线路由器,用于建立无线局域网并与外部设备建立无线连接; 连接状态查询模块,用于查询连接状态为成功的设备; 数量统计模块,用于统计查询连接状态为成功的设备总数量; 处理模块,包括带宽获取模块、带宽计算模块、带宽分配模块,其中带宽获取模块用于获取无线路由器总带宽;所述带宽计算模块用于根据所述带宽获取模块获得总带宽和数量统计模块获得的设备总数量,计算获得每个连入设备的平均带宽;所述带宽分配模块用于根据所获得的每个连入设备的平均带宽对无线路由器的总带宽进行分配和设置。
2.根据权利要求1所述用于无线路由器的IP带宽平均分配系统,其特征在于:所述连接状态查询模块为实时查询连接状态为成功的设备。
3.根据权利要求1所述用于无线路由器的IP带宽平均分配系统,其特征在于:还包括与连接状态查询模块相连的计时模块,所述计时模块用于设置预定时间,在时间到达预定时间时生成触发信号至连接状态查询模块。
4.根据权利要求1所述用于无线路由器的IP带宽平均分配系统,其特征在于:还包括与连接状态查询模块相连的复位模块。
5.根据权利要求1所述用于无线路由器的IP带宽平均分配系统,其特征在于:所述带宽计算模块采用AT89S51型单片机。
【专利摘要】本发明公开了一种用于无线路由器的IP带宽平均分配系统,包括:无线路由器,用于建立无线局域网并建立无线连接;连接状态查询模块,用于查询连接状态为成功的设备;数量统计模块,用于统计查询设备的总数量;处理模块,包括带宽获取模块、带宽计算模块、带宽分配模块,其中带宽获取模块用于获取总带宽;所述带宽计算模块用于根据所述带宽获取模块获得总带宽和数量统计模块获得的设备总数量,计算获得每个连入设备的平均带宽;所述带宽分配模块用于根据所获得的每个连入设备的平均带宽对无线路由器的总带宽进行分配和设置。本发明,可以充分利用带宽资源,提高带宽资源的使用效率,具备自动分配功能,使得连入的设备容易造成IP带宽分配均匀。
【IPC分类】H04L12-917
【公开号】CN104753824
【申请号】CN201510143645
【发明人】章隆泉, 陈伟新, 顾肖红
【申请人】无锡市崇安区科技创业服务中心
【公开日】2015年7月1日
【申请日】2015年3月30日
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1